The University of Central Oklahoma's School of Music will celebrate the holiday season with a choral & orchestra concert at 7:30 p.m., Dec. 3 at Mitchell Hall Theater on the UCO campus.
The holiday concert will include holiday classics like "The Nutcracker Suite," "Ave Maria" and "Fantasia on Christmas Carols" performed by UCO's Concert Chorale, Cantilena and Chamber Singers as well as Central's Symphony Orchestra, featuring guest soloist, cellist Aleksa Asanovic.
Asanovic is cello professor, soloist, pedagogue and director and founder of the cello school in Montenegro. He was the first Montenegrin cellist to perform important cello parts throughout Europe with 40 different pianists and conductors.
